Former Kotoko coach Prosper Ogum appointed as head coach of Ghana U17 boys team

The Executive Council of the Ghana Football Association (GFA) has appointed former Asante Kotoko head coach Prosper Narteh Ogum as the new head coach Black Starlet, Ghana’s U17 boys national team.

The former Kotoko manager takes over from Coach Frimpong Manso, who is now turning all attention to the busy campaign of Ghana Premier League champions Bibiani Gold Stars who is set to compete in the CAF Champions League in the 2025/26 football season.

“The Executive Council has appointed Dr. Prosper Narteh Ogum as the new head coach of the Ghana U17 national team, the Black Starlets, ahead of the upcoming WAFU Zone B U17 Boys Championship in Nigeria and has also been handed the role of Head of Coach Education, replacing Desmond Ofei.
